The Opportunity

This position works out of our Pleasanton, CA location in the Heart Failure division. In Abbotts Heart Failure (HF) business, were developing solutions to diagnose, monitor and manage heart failure, allowing people to restore their health and get on with their lives.

In this role you are responsible for directing the manufacturing operations performed in a shift or group of production lines, ensuring they reach volume, quality and cost goals.

What Youll Work On

Lead and manage daily operations of the packaging department to ensure efficiency and productivity.

Supervise, train, and develop packaging staff, fostering a culture of safety, quality, and continuous improvement.

Provide performance feedback and input to managers for appraisal of exempt employees; write and conduct appraisals for employees.

Schedule and assign tasks to ensure optimal staffing and workflow.

Ensure all packaging meets company quality standards and complies with regulatory requirements.

Conduct regular inspections and audits to identify and resolve quality issues.

Collaborate with Quality Assurance and cross-functional teams to address non-conformances.

Monitor packaging processes and identify opportunities for improvement in efficiency, cost, and waste reduction. Implement lean manufacturing principles and continuous improvement initiatives.

Coordinate with inventory and supply chain teams to ensure adequate packaging materials are available.

Provide or locate technical expertise and guidance for day-to-day problems.

Track usage and manage inventory levels to prevent shortages or overstock.

Maintain accurate records of safety incidents and corrective actions.

Understand detailed area operations (function-specific). Regularly make decisions that impact quality, time, or cost. Timely decisions are required regarding issues such as whether to proceed or abort, work overtime, etc. Manage assigned projects and work cross-functionally to identify changes and necessary resources.

Assist employees in the creation of development plans and work with them to meet their development needs.

Enforce safety protocols and ensure compliance with OSHA and company safety standards.

Coach floor teams by providing guidance, direction, training, and resources.

Participate in and lead cross-functional teams to meet specific objectives.

Create a climate of trust and respect within the organization.

Maintain detailed records of production output, downtime, and other key performance indicators.

Conduct discussions with employees, including performance reviews, development, discipline, and staffing interviews.

Prepare and present reports on packaging performance, issues, and improvements to management.

Participate in meetings and contribute to strategic planning and decision-making.

Ensure GMP and regulatory compliance : Follow and work within ISO and GMP standards, perform GMP audits of the area, and allocate time and resources for ongoing GMP and regulatory training.

Provide information with appropriate clarity, timeliness, and frequency to meet the needs of the receiver. Distribute background information prior to meetings and conferences, provide adequate response time when making requests, and keep parties potentially affected by decisions apprised of events.

Confront issues that block individual and team performance. Voice opinions and concerns proactively, and work to establish areas of difference as well as common interest.

Recognize and reward performance : Jointly establish realistic yet challenging performance expectations with direct reports, provide ongoing feedback, use financial and non-financial rewards to recognize individual and team performance, and publicize accomplishments within the organization.

Plan for development of direct reports : Assess strengths and development needs, provide feedback, contribute to development plans, and offer opportunities for growth, learning, and job enrichment.

Recognize risk in relation to procedures and take appropriate action.

Identify and implement cost reductions.

Provide budget recommendations, perform cost reduction and variance analysis.

Required Qualifications

Bachelor's degree engineering discipline

2+ years' experience in a GMP Manufacturing Environment

Preferred Qualifications

4+ years of related work experience

Experience with packaging and sterilizing processes

Supervisor / Management experience, managing team of operators is preferred
